llmopt

Training that uses the weight budget as a capacity-achieving code can make calibration machinery unnecessary; this lab measures when that statement holds.

Headlines (each carries its full scope in FINDINGS)

  • Masking a 30B-class MoE to its top-45.3%-demand experts beats the full model on the lab's mathematics gate (+14.7 pooled, 6/6 paired seeds); random masks at the same fraction score 0/120 — selection, not sparsity (FINDINGS, routing crest).
  • Capability follows expert identity, not any aggregate of the keep-set: with recall and coverage pinned, exchanging 4 experts per layer per class between matched keep-set draws moved 23–52 gate solves per side and largely inverted the pair outcomes; recall- and coverage-organization both returned registered nulls first.
  • A transformer birth (multi-block, real math diet, 1000 steps) runs bit-identically across Mac CPU, RTX 3080 CUDA, and an external lab's C++ reimplementation — integer training with sha-equality as the acceptance bar, reproducible by one command (REPRODUCE).

These are measured, fenced claims — the tags and scope vocabulary in FINDINGS are part of each statement, not optional reading.

What was built

llmopt is a mathematics and physics research lab organized around executable instruments, declared comparisons, and oracle-checked readouts. The main paths are:

  • llmopt/search/ — symbolic derivation search with explicit rewrite rules, structural and learned evaluators, proposal policies, transposition memory, and verification at the boundary.
  • llmopt/mathgen/ — seeded generators for calculus, linear algebra, ordinary differential equations, mechanics, and proofs, with symbolic checks built into generation or evaluation.
  • llmopt/quantum/ — model-Hamiltonian ground-state instruments and a verified ZX-graph search path for circuit reduction.
  • llmopt/train/ and llmopt/intmath.py — closed-system model births, exact integer primitives, controlled diets, and training interventions that can be compared trajectory by trajectory.
  • llmopt/quantize/ — weight diagnostics, sensitivity probes, closed-form allocation, packed crystal artifacts, and the capacity meter that selects which allocation regime deserves testing.
  • llmopt/eval/ — equivalence, calibration, latency, and statistical instruments used as supporting readouts rather than substitutes for capability gates.

Experiments are recorded as named arms and cells. A gate accepts or rejects a declared result; a pin fixes an artifact or trajectory contract. Those words, the maturity labels, and the controlled scope vocabulary are defined in GLOSSARY.md.

What was discovered

  • [SINGLE-SEED] [REGIME-SCOPED: at-capacity house crystals] The house crystals tested at capacity could be packed from weight sigma alone, with no calibration data or allocator search, while remaining inside their declared capability gate. This is a Mac MPS, n=1-per-crystal result, not a universal quantization rule: PACKED CRYSTAL C0+C1 VERDICT in docs/RESULTS.md.

  • [SINGLE-SEED] [DEVICE-SCOPED] [FORMAT-BOUND] [REGIME-SCOPED: Qwen2.5-0.5B] THE SIGMA-PACK CLAIM DOES NOT TRANSPORT TO Qwen2.5-0.5B. On the registered RTX 3080 fake-quant arm, max-anchored and calibrated grids exploited weight-tail structure that the house crystals did not have. The boundary is one model, one device, and n=1; it is not a law of web-trained dense models: PACKED CRYSTAL C6 VERDICT and PACKED CRYSTAL C6c VERDICT in docs/RESULTS.md.

  • [REPLICATED] [DEVICE-SCOPED] [FORMAT-BOUND] [REGIME-SCOPED: measured deployment artifacts] The packed integer GEMM path reproduced its digest across the registered Mac MPS and RTX 3080 CUDA devices. This independent-device route covers one house crystal's integer GEMM path, not a full integer end-to-end decoder: PACKED CRYSTAL C4 VERDICT and R-PASS VERDICT in docs/RESULTS.md.

  • [NULL] [DEVICE-SCOPED] [FREE-RUN-GATED] [REGIME-SCOPED: specified diet and recipe] Removing scaffold-token loss did not repair the registered gravmoe capability gate; the arm degraded while its format diagnostics remained intact. This is a Mac-local n=1 null: VERDICT SOL-ADOPTION-1 in docs/RESULTS.md.

  • [REPLICATED] [FORMAT-BOUND] [FREE-RUN-GATED] [REGIME-SCOPED: measured deployment artifacts] A resident 30B-class MoE scored HIGHER on the registered mathematics gate with 45.3% of its experts masked out than at full width, +14.7 pooled across six paired seeds. The effect is selection, not sparsity: random and anti-demand masks at the identical fraction scored 0/120. It is also domain-specific — the same recipe on mechanics returned +3 and then -59 pooled, with open and closed recall matched to the mathematics arm to within 0.0001 and 0.003, so coverage and recall do not predict the sign of the effect. The scope is one vehicle, one keep rule, one gate, and Mac MLX: VERDICT MOE-GT-1-R5, VERDICT MOE-GT-1-R6, and VERDICT MOE-GT-2-D4-PHYS-B in docs/RESULTS.md.

What can be reproduced today

RJOB_LOCAL=1 python -m llmopt.reproduce gravmoe-rb1

On the current Mac-local contract, PASS means the final training-trajectory digest exactly matches the committed gravmoe-rb1 pin. The adopted command is booked by VERDICT SOL-ADOPTION-1 in docs/RESULTS.md; repository commit 4ef9cd511369023d69db7332aebf36517de62951 made the path self-contained from committed windows.

Trajectory agreement is not oracle correctness. It certifies the pinned weight path and teacher-forced training readouts. Free-run symbolic solve scoring additionally needs the uncommitted diet row text and its oracle; the artifact-backed gate arms therefore run in an explicit trajectory-only mode.

The walkthrough in docs/REPRODUCE.md explains setup, expected output, the full pin registry, and where oracle-backed correctness claims live. Use python -m llmopt.reproduce --list to inspect the registry; do not interpret digest equality as a capability score.

What remains uncertain

The calibration-free packing law is established only for the measured at-capacity house crystals. The negative PACKED CRYSTAL C6 VERDICT is equally narrow: Qwen2.5-0.5B, one registered RTX 3080 device, fake quantization, and n=1. More models, independent implementations, and capability-gated deployment artifacts are needed before either boundary can move.

Many training comparisons remain single-seed and device-scoped. The README keeps those fences visible; docs/FINDINGS.md carries the current maturity labels, and docs/BOARD.md separates live work from closed results.

Why masking a deployed MoE to its demand coalition beats full width on mathematics is unexplained, and the two quantities a keep rule optimizes — coverage and recall of demanded experts — were measured not to predict even the sign of that effect. One piece is now measured, and a same-night control inverted it. A matched-size random fill resurrected a dead core about as well as the verbal-branch fill (51/36/48 versus 55 of 120), which read as coverage-not-class — but that random pool was itself about 45 percent verbal-branch experts. Fills that exclude the verbal branch at the same recall score 0 and 7 of 120, against 16 to 55 for fills that include it, and a recall ladder over random fills is non-monotone (a 0.795-recall draw scores 9; a 0.792 draw scores 66). So the verbal population is necessary for the resurrection and recall does not organize it; what is sufficient is still unmeasured, with two named anomalies open. Why the crest beats full width remains unexplained, and the crest stays a booked observation on one vehicle and one domain, not a deployment recommendation.

Trajectory reproduction still stops short of self-contained free-run oracle scoring because the row text is not committed. Until that input can be shared lawfully, the public artifact proves the trajectory and teacher-forced readouts only.
